A Research Of Carbon Emissions Performance And Marginal Abatement Costs Of Construction Industry In China

In the process of industrialization and urbanization in China,the construction industry has been a pillar industry of the national economy over a long period of time,and has made great contribution to the development of economy and society.However,the construction industry is a typical ‘high impact,high emission' industry,although its energy consumption has been relatively small,but the building materials(cement,steel)has leaded huge amounts of carbon emissions,which has been ignored by researchers.At the meantime,the national carbon trading market is going to be established,the differential pricing is difficult.In this context,the study for carbon emission performance and marginal abatement cost of construction industry in China's provinces,is significant for carbon emission reduction and sustainable development,and provides a reference for the pricing of carbon trading market.Using the global generalized directional distance function,to calculate the carbon emission performance of construction industry in China's provinces during 2004 to 2014;the dynamic change of carbon emission performance is indicated by the Global-Malmquist-Luenberger index;and testing the convergence properties of the regional construction industry carbon emission performance;finally,using non-parametric shadow price model to calculate the shadow prices of carbon emission.The conclusions are as follows:The carbon emission performance of construction industry is highest in the Western Zone,is medium-level in the Middle Zone,is lowest in the East Zone.Considering the eight regions,the Southwest Area and the Northwest Area are highest and the Middle reaches of Yangtze River is lowest.In 2004~2014,the carbon emission performance of construction industry showed a downward trend,especially in 2007~2011,but upward trend has been showed in the Eastern Coast.The technological progress and efficiency improvement of carbon emissions performance of construction industry are neither obvious nor coordinated;only the Eastern Coast has showed significant technical progress and efficiency improvement.In most areas,there is ? convergence,there is not ? convergence.In 2004~2014,for 30 provinces,the average shadow price of carbon emissions of construction industry was 2.350 thousand yuan per ton,which is lower than the industrial sector,but still relatively high.Overall,provinces and areas of higher carbon emissions had smaller shadow price(marginal abatement cost),vice versa;provinces and areas of higher carbon emission performance had smaller the shadow price(marginal abatement cost),vice versa;most but not all the provinces has meted above rules.According to the carbon emission performance and marginal abatement costs,the 30 provinces will be divided into four types,namely,"high performance and high cost","high performance and low cost","low performance and high cost" and "low performance and low cost".
